What Takes place Throughout a Specialist Art Assessment



The First Evaluation: Condition and Authenticity



When art appraisers arrive to examine a collection, the first thing they examine is condition. Oakland's Bay Location environment, with its characteristic morning fog, changing moisture, and occasional warm spikes in the summertime, can take a toll on canvas, paper, and mixed-media persuades time. Moisture from the bay air leaks right into structures and causes warping. UV exposure from big west-facing home windows discolors pigments in manner ins which are unnoticeable initially however substance over years.



A specialist examiner will examine the physical stability of each piece, trying to find indicators of reconstruction, craquelure, foxing on paper works, and any structural damage that reduces market value. Credibility confirmation follows closely behind, making use of provenance documents, certifications, event documents, and occasionally clinical evaluation such as infrared reflectography or pigment screening.



Investigating Similar Sales



When condition is established, the appraiser turns to market information. This action entails investigating recent sales of similar works by the same musician or from the very same motion. Auction records, gallery sales information, and exclusive deal databases all feed into this evaluation.



For enthusiasts in Oakland, regional market dynamics matter. The Bay Area keeps a solid neighborhood of art buyers, and local rate of interest in California-based artists, Chicano art, and Bay Location Figurative Motion works can press values higher below than in markets somewhere else. An appraiser that comprehends the local context brings real included value to this phase of the process.

Recognizing Assessment Styles and Their Function



Fair Market Value vs. Insurance Replacement Worth



Not all evaluations serve the same objective, and the desired usage forms exactly how value obtains determined. A fair market price appraisal shows what a willing purchaser would certainly pay an eager seller in an open market, the common utilized for estate tax find out more filings, philanthropic donations, and fair distribution during estate negotiations.



An insurance coverage substitute value appraisal functions differently. It mirrors the expense of changing a deal with among similar top quality in the present retail market, generally a greater figure. Oakland home owners who bring substantial collections must have insurance assessments updated every three to 5 years, especially offered how substantially the market for sure groups of contemporary and modern-day job has moved considering that the early 2020s.

Preparing Your Collection Prior To the Evaluator Arrives



Collecting documentation ahead of the appointment saves time and produces more precise results. Pull together any type of purchase receipts, gallery invoices, exhibit directories, or document pertaining to each item. Photo operates in great natural light before the appointment, noting any existing damage you are currently knowledgeable about. Clear the room around huge jobs so the evaluator can take a look at all four sides of a canvas or sculpture without obstruction.



If you have works in storage space, prepare to have them obtainable on the day of the visit. Evaluators can not value what they can not see, and things left in climate-uncontrolled areas may require added documents concerning the length of time they have been stored and under what problems.
